LITTLE RED….WHAT?

As if by magic, two little red-roofed structures have sprung up on the waterfront across from A. H. Riise, near the St. John ferry.
I've noticed on my morning walks a couple of patches of torn up concrete there, and, from time to time, a yellow sawhorse marking the spot(s). And now, voila!, two comely little red. . . . tings?
I decided to find out what they were, and what better place to start than the Port Authority.
I spoke to the operator who directed me to the engineering department, who directed me to the property department, who directed me back to the engineering department, and all at record speed.
They were all impeccably polite and sympathized with my distress. They referred me to their head engineer, who is off-island until tomorrow.
I've lived here for a very long time, and tomorrow might be too late. Tomorrow they might be gone. It wouldn't be the first time. (Remember the Sinbad Festival booths?)
Anyhow, they're a nice touch on the waterfront. Perhaps they will put some benches underneath. Who knows?
Oh, they forgot their sawhorse.
